Back in 2016, few people could have imagined that Lionel Messi's international career would become one of football's greatest comeback stories.
After Argentina's painful Copa America final defeat against Chile, Messi announced his retirement from international football. The disappointment of losing another major final had become too much to bear.
At the time, it felt like the end of an era.
Fast forward a decade, and the football world is witnessing something entirely different.
Rather than fading away, Messi has transformed disappointment into one of the most remarkable chapters in sporting history.
The player who once questioned his future with Argentina now stands among the greatest international footballers ever to play the game.
His decision to return changed everything.
Since reversing his retirement, Messi has helped lead Argentina through a golden period that supporters had dreamed about for generations.
The team captured multiple major trophies, including Copa America success and the long-awaited FIFA World Cup triumph that cemented Messi's legacy.

Many players struggle to maintain elite performance in their late thirties.
Messi continues to produce decisive moments on football's biggest stage.
What makes his achievements even more impressive is the consistency.
While many stars experience decline with age, Messi has adapted his game intelligently.
He relies less on explosive speed and more on positioning, vision, awareness, and technical quality.
The result is a footballer who remains capable of deciding matches with a single touch.
